摘要
Sol-gel processing was used to obtain two different kinds of confined structures for photonic applications: (i) Er3+-activated sol-gel silica derived spherical microresonators and (ii) Er3+-activated silica inverse opal. Optical and spectroscopic assessment, as well as morphological and structural characterization of the systems, were performed. (C) 2008 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
